Toronto’s Gay Men’s Chorus, Forte, Kicks Off Pride Month with Powerful Union Station Performance Toronto, ON – June 5, 2025 – Forte, Toronto’s acclaimed gay men’s chorus, launched Pride Month with a vibrant and moving performance at Union Station on June 4th. The surprise flash mob-style performance, captured on video, quickly went viral, showcasing Forte's talent and the city's vibrant LGBTQ+ community. The chorus filled the station's upper level with their voices, captivating commuters and passersby with a powerful rendition of a song. One audience member, Sarah Miller, commented, "It was absolutely breathtaking. The energy was infectious, and it really brought a sense of joy and community to the space." The performance served as a preview for Forte's upcoming concert at Trinity-St. Paul’s United Church on June 14th. The chorus's artistic director, David Lee, stated, "We wanted to bring the spirit of Pride to the heart of the city, sharing our music and celebrating the diversity of Toronto."
